I have a 2006 Tracker Q4 (19.6") with the 4.3 mercruiser i/o engine. Currently have a 14x23 aluminum prop. Looking to replace with stainless.
I have had this boat 4 years and always have issues with getting out of hole, planing out and porposing. Spoke with Tracker about these issues and I am not sold on there advice.
They suggested a 13.75x21 stainless. Will this correct the planing issue and the bouncing issue? I have never had a boat that struggles to plane out. Also trying to determine what is the best prop for the money. Solas, Michigan Wheel, Vengeance, Stilleto?

You need to know your WOT rpms before you start prop playing.
Changing props can give you better hole shot, but will lower your top speed.
You can have better low end torque, for towing. Better mid-range hole shot. Or shoot maximum top speed, but you can't have all 3. There is always a trade off when swapping props.
Planing and porposing is more of a function of the trim and if you know how to use it.
